EDE POLY to Refund Students as Collection of Logbook commences

The Students union of the federal polytechnic Ede, Osun state (EDE POLY), have said that students who already paid for logbook at their various department money would be refunded starting from next week.
The student union stated this in a Press statement released on Friday adding that collection of SIWES LOGBOOK will commence starting from Thursday 5th May 2022.
The press statement which in part Reads;
“Student’s Union in a meeting held earlier today with Dr, Amusan(Dean of Applied science and the Siwes director towards restoring a balance measure on the aforementioned.
“It’s of great pleasure to convey to all Siwes Students with assurance from the Siwes director in person of Eng, Dr E. A. Oluwasola that the Logbook will be ready for collection unfailingly next week Thursday.

“Honoring the aforesaid, All Siwes Students are enjoined to come to the SIWES office starting from nextweek thursday for the collection of their Siwes Log Book.
“All the affected Students(SIWES) that has already purchased the Siwes Log Book from their various department should kindly head back to their department for the collection of their money.”
